Technical Field
The application relates to the technical field of landscape buildings, in particular to a multifunctional corridor frame.
Background
The corridor frame is a building structure arranged in a scenic spot, a square or a park, can play a role in connecting a plurality of landscape buildings and organizing and connecting tour routes in series, and can also provide a place for visitors to rest and view.
The patent document with the application number of 202021207030.7 discloses a gallery frame, which comprises a gallery frame column arranged on the ground and a gallery frame top arranged at one end, back to the ground, of the gallery frame column; the corridor frame column comprises a foundation column which is made of metal materials and is arranged on the ground and a batten veneer which is fixedly connected to the surface of the foundation column and used for wrapping the foundation column; the gallery top includes a peripheral frame made of a metal material and a plurality of grid plates disposed in the peripheral frame; the foundation column is fixedly connected with the peripheral frame.
With respect to the related art among the above, the inventors consider that the following problems exist: this corridor frame need follow the length direction symmetry of corridor frame and set up the corridor frame post and support the corridor frame top to guarantee structural stability, consequently, need use more material to carry out the construction of corridor frame, the construction cost is higher.

Detailed Description
The present application is described in further detail below with reference to figures 1-5.
The embodiment of the application discloses a multifunctional corridor frame.
Referring to fig. 1 and 2, multi-functional corridor frame includes bench 1, corridor top 2 and a plurality of corridor post 3, and bench 1 is used for providing the rest seat for the visitor, and a plurality of corridor posts 3 set up in one side of bench 1 length direction, and the upper end of corridor post 3 forms supporting part 31 towards one side horizontal bending of bench 1, and corridor top 2 sets up in the top of supporting part 31. Therefore, the corridor top 2 of the corridor frame is fixed only by arranging the corridor columns 3 on one side, the used building materials are relatively less, and the cost for constructing the corridor frame is saved.
Referring to fig. 2 and 3, corridor post 3 includes corridor post body 32, fixed plate 33 and backplate 34, corridor post body 32 is the I-steel strip, and fixed plate 33 has two and two fixed plates 33 to be located corridor post body 32's two notches respectively, and fixed plate 33 and corridor post body 32 enclose out two cavitys, and the cavity intussuseption is filled with thermal-insulated cotton to reducible corridor post 3 is with absorptive outside release, makes the visitor in the corridor frame more comfortable relatively. The guard plate 34 has two and the guard plate 34 covers the both sides face of establishing in corridor post body 32 worker, and the both sides border of guard plate 34 length direction is rolled up inwards and is formed buckle portion 341, and buckle portion 341 butt joint is in order to reduce the condition that fixed plate 33 breaks away from corridor post body 32 in the fixed plate 33. Furthermore, in order to make the connection of the fixing plate 33 and the gallery post body 32 relatively tighter. The corridor post body 32 welds the restriction strip 321 that extends along corridor post body 32 length direction, and restriction strip 321 is the angle billet, and fixed plate 33 and restriction strip 321 are all worn to be equipped with the bolt and fixed plate 33 passes through bolt fixed connection in restriction strip 321.
Referring to fig. 2, the lower end of the porch column 3 is provided with a base 4, the base 4 comprising a base 41, a masonry pile 42 and a fixing bar 43. The base 41 is formed by pouring concrete, the base 41 is located in the ground, and a reinforcing mesh is poured in the base 41 together for improving the structural strength of the base 41. The connecting plate 322 that corridor post body 32 lower extreme integrated into one piece had the level to set up, connecting plate 322 butt in base 41, and connecting plate 322 below is provided with steel reinforcement cage 323, and the one end bolt that connecting plate 322 and steel reinforcement cage 323 wore out connecting plate 322 is worn to locate in steel reinforcement cage 323's upper end has the nut to be used for reducing the condition that steel reinforcement cage 323 breaks away from connecting plate 322, and the lower extreme steel reinforcement level of steel reinforcement cage 323 is buckled for difficult quilt is pulled out base 41 after the reinforcing bar atress.
In order to prevent the lower end of the gallery post body 32 from deforming easily, a plurality of reinforcing ribs 324 are welded on the side wall of the lower end of the gallery post body 32, the reinforcing ribs 324 are arranged along the circumferential direction of the side wall of the lower end of the gallery post body 32, the reinforcing ribs 324 are welded on the connecting plate 322, meanwhile, a protecting block 325 is further poured on the lower end of the gallery post body 32, the protecting block 325 is fixedly connected with the base 41, and the connecting plate 322 and the reinforcing ribs 324 are located in the protecting block 325.
The masonry pile 42 is arranged above the base 41, the masonry pile 42 is located on one side, back to the bench 1, of the corridor column body 32, the protection net 421 is coated outside the masonry pile 42, and the protection net 421 can coat a plurality of stones, so that the stones are not prone to scattering. Thus, the base 41 and the masonry pile 42 increase the weight of the lower end of the galley pillar body 32 so that the galley pillar 3 is less likely to tip over. In addition, in order to make the center of gravity of the corridor frame reduce, improve the structural stability of the corridor frame, the corridor column body 32 is obliquely arranged and makes the corridor column 3 and the supporting part 31 be a 7-shaped structure.
The fixing strip 43 is formed by stone bars and extends along the length direction of the gallery frame, and the fixing strip 43 is fixed on the upper end face of the base 41 and is positioned on one side of the gallery post body 32, which is back to the stone pile 42. Bench 1 is disposed above fixing strip 43, and fixing strip 43 not only can be used to fix bench 1 but also can be used to increase the weight of the lower end of porch post body 32, lowering the center of gravity of porch post body 32.
Referring to fig. 2, the bench 1 includes a seat plate 11, a backrest 12, and support ribs 13. The seat plate 11 is a plate-shaped structure formed by a plurality of rectangular battens distributed at equal intervals along the width direction of the upper end surface of the fixing strip 43, and the backrest 12 is also formed by rectangular battens distributed at equal intervals. One side edge of the seat plate 11 far away from the backrest 12 is bent towards the base 41 to form a transition part 111, the radial section of the transition part 111 is of a curved arc-shaped structure, and the arc opening of the transition part 111 faces the fixing strip 43, so that the transition part 111 can coat the corner part of the fixing strip 43 positioned on the outer side and form an outward convex arc-shaped structure, the seat plate 11 is more suitable for the sitting posture structure of a human body, a visitor is more comfortable when having a rest, and the transition part 111 can also reduce the condition that the corner part of the fixing strip 43 is injured when the visitor collides.
In addition, in order to make the structure of the backrest 12 more firm, the guest is not easy to topple over during the leaning process. The support ribs 13 are arranged on one side of the backrest 12 facing the corridor column 3, the support ribs 13 are provided with a plurality of support ribs 13 which are distributed at equal intervals along the length direction of the backrest 12, the support ribs 13 are of plate-shaped structures, one side edge of each support rib 13 is provided with a screw and fixedly connected to the backrest 12, and the lower end of each support rib 13 is fixedly connected to the fixing strip 43. Thus, the support rib 13 can support the backrest 12, so that the backrest 12 is not prone to toppling.
Referring to fig. 2 and 4, the galley roof 2 includes a plurality of cross members 21 and transparent plates 22, the cross members 21 are columnar structures and perpendicular to the support portions 31, and the cross members 21 are welded to the support portions 31 or connected to the support portions 31 by bolts. The transparent plate 22 may be made of glass or transparent rubber, the side of the beam 21 facing the transparent plate 22 is coated with adhesive, and the transparent plate 22 is attached to the beam 21 by the adhesive. In order to make the connection between the transparent plate 22 and the beam 21 relatively tighter, the transparent plate 22 is penetrated by a fixing bolt, the fixing bolt is screwed to the beam 21, and the bolt head of the fixing bolt presses the transparent plate 22 against the beam 21.
Referring to fig. 2 and 5, the porch shelf can have a good lighting effect at night. An illuminating lamp 5 is fixedly connected to an end of the supporting portion 31, and the illuminating lamp 5 is disposed on a side of the supporting portion 31 facing the bench 1. Meanwhile, a lamp groove 431 is formed in one side, back to the corridor column 3, of the fixing strip 43, the lamp groove 431 extends along the length direction of the fixing strip 43, the lamp groove 431 is located on one side, close to the base 41, of the fixing strip 43, and a lamp strip 432 is fixedly connected in the lamp groove 431. Therefore, the illuminating lamp 5 can provide illumination, and the light bars 432 arranged on the fixing strips 43 can also provide illumination, so that visitors in the corridor frame can have better illumination conditions at night and are not easy to trip over.
The implementation principle of this application embodiment multi-functional corridor frame does: the corridor top 2 is supported only by the support part 31 bent by the corridor column 3 at one side, and the material for supporting is relatively less during construction, so that the cost for constructing the corridor frame is lower. The base 41 arranged at the lower end of the gallery pillar body 32 can ensure that the gallery pillar body 32 is not easy to turn over, and the building stone pile 42 and the fixing strip 43 are arranged for increasing the weight of the end part of the gallery pillar body 32, so that the center of gravity is reduced, and the structure of the gallery frame is more stable. The light 5 that sets up in addition can make the corridor frame also can provide comparatively bright illumination when night, improves the rate of utilization at night of corridor frame.
